At issue is whether, pursuant to the Uniform Declaratory Act, N.J.S.A. 2A:16-50 to -62, a private passenger automobile insurer providing personal injury protection (PIP) coverage may seek expansive discovery from assignee health service providers in its internal investigation of suspected insurance fraud.
